I'm planning on deploying a Splunk infrastructure.
I'm currently undecided whether I should build the infrastructure according to the following configurations.
1 Search Head for each data center (hosted on ESX)
1 Indexer for each datacenter (hosted on ESX)
OR
2 Indexers for each datacenter (hosted on ESX)
With 1 indexer on each site, I planned to have a replication factor of 2 and a search factor of 2 and a site-rep-factor of 1.
With 2 indexers on each site a replication factor of 4 and a search factor of 3 and a site-rep-factor of 2.
Is it advisable to host 2 smaller indexers instead of one big indexer?
Are there performance benefits or caveats?
